Flea Market by College Foundation on Cambridge Campus of Anoka-Ramsey Community College yields success September 29, 2003

Community members attending Flea Market Community members attending Flea Market
Community members turned out to hunt for treasures and support scholarships for students to attend college at Anoka-Ramsey Community College during the Flea Market/Garage Sale, Sept. 13. This event was organized by the Foundation on the Cambridge Campus of the College


More than $1,200 was raised for student scholarships to attend college during the first annual Flea Market/Garage Sale sponsored by Anoka-Ramsey Community College's Cambridge Campus Foundation, Sept. 13. Seventeen vendors participated in the event by donating $40 per vendor space. Other participated by donating items to the Foundation to be sold for the fundraiser.

"This year was a great start to what we hope will become an annual event," says event Co-Chair and Anoka-Ramsey Community College Faculty Member, Mark Widdel. "Next year we are hoping for an even greater mix of vendors: home-grown garden items, crafts and more local retailers."
